在线观看不卡亚洲电影_亚洲妓女99综合网_91青青青亚洲娱乐在线观看_日韩无码高清综合久久

鍍金池/ 問答/ HTML問答
失魂人 回答

使用chooseWXPay(wx.config之后)不需要appId的
可以參考https://mp.weixin.qq.com/wiki...
注意好參數(shù)的大小寫就行

clipboard.png

情已空 回答

那只有用圖片來兼容了
最好的方法是說服你們老板不用兼容

萌小萌 回答

你jquery沒有在index.html中引用吧

刮刮樂 回答

假如你的配置沒錯的話,第二次你是不是傳了相同的圖片,圖片不能重復(fù)上傳的,隊列中文件已經(jīng)存在了

貓小柒 回答

@HankBass 兄弟說得很對

總得試試,實在不行就找會同樣的公司對吧^_^
不過人在他鄉(xiāng),辭職前先存錢存夠2~3個月生活費 / 騎驢找馬

近義詞 回答

你的項目用到了 nightwatch 包,這個包的安裝會從 Google 云存儲下載必要的文件。如果你沒有翻墻的話,下載就會失敗。就變成這樣了。

神曲 回答

clipboard.png
紅色框放登錄框, 并且z-index:設(shè)置的高于canvas;阻止掉登錄框部分的默認(rèn)事件;保證canvas 不會影響到登錄功能;其次就是登錄框除紅色框部分不能有元素壓蓋canvas;不然就會失去canvas的交互;
究其原因: 結(jié)構(gòu)樣式問題;

墻頭草 回答

axios可以執(zhí)行多個并發(fā)請求

function getUserAccount() {
  return axios.get('/user/12345');
}

function getUserPermissions() {
  return axios.get('/user/12345/permissions');
}

axios.all([getUserAccount(), getUserPermissions()])
  .then(axios.spread(function (acct, perms) {
    // 兩個請求現(xiàn)在都執(zhí)行完成
  }));
有點壞 回答

<style>

  body {
    padding: 0;
    margin: 0;
  }
.box {
  width: 102px;
  height: 102px;
  position: relative;
  box-sizing: border-box;
}
.boxItem{
  height: 100px;
  width: 25px;
  border:1px solid grey;
}
.box > .boxItem:nth-child(1) {
  background: yellow;
  position: absolute;
  left: 0;
}
.box > .boxItem:nth-child(2){
  position: absolute;
  top: -38px;
  left: 38px;
  transform: rotate(-90deg);
  z-index: 4;
  background: red;
}
.box > .boxItem:nth-child(3){
  position: absolute;
  right: 0px;
  top: 0;
  z-index: 3;
  background: pink;
}
.box > .boxItem:nth-child(4){
  position: absolute;
  left: 37px;
  transform: rotate(-90deg);
  z-index: 2;
  top: 38px;
  background: #3c3baa;
}

  
</style>


  <div class="box">
    <div class="boxItem"></div>
    <div class="boxItem"></div>
    <div class="boxItem"></div>
    <div class="boxItem"></div>
  </div>
半心人 回答

因為redux-saga幫你做了。
你在dipsatch的時候,就是相當(dāng)于執(zhí)行了其next()方法

解夏 回答

你ua在字典中只調(diào)用了一次。
這樣就行了

for url in range(5):
    header["User-Agent"] = ua()
    print header
法克魷 回答

var aaa = 321 === this.aaa=321

你定義的是全局變量 this===window

window.aaa===this.aaa

單眼皮 回答

你這問題應(yīng)該使用付費問答 你這太拿來主義了

悶騷型 回答

1、state
redux中只維護一個store樹,這個樹下存儲各個模塊的state
2、dispatch
表明觸發(fā)了一個修改state的操作,且只能通過dispatch觸發(fā)修改。它的參數(shù)是一個action,看下面
3、action
action表示當(dāng)前dispatch(操作)的類型和載荷(數(shù)據(jù))(payload),比方說我要修改系統(tǒng)主題色,那這個action可能就這么定義了{type: 'CHANGE_THEME', color: 'red'},其中type是約定俗成的參數(shù),且必填
4、reducer
是一個純函數(shù),用來修改state的,接收兩個參數(shù) state和action,生成一個新的state返回

補充
先了解redux基礎(chǔ)實現(xiàn),暫不用管react-redux,react-redux只是redux在react下的應(yīng)用,redux也可以和angular、原生js結(jié)合使用。所以有時候你看到的provider、connect只是在react下應(yīng)用而已,不屬于redux核心概念的范疇。
1、provider
要了解provider必須知道react中context的概念,通過context可以將組件狀態(tài)store傳遞到各個子組件,而不需要顯示的props一層一層傳遞下去。react-redux中就是將store存在了context中
2、connect
顧名思義,起到了鏈接的作用。store傳遞到子組件需要通過connect鏈接來建立prop和state、prop和dispatch的對應(yīng)關(guān)系。它會統(tǒng)一的從context中取出store, 然后store中的數(shù)據(jù)都是通過mapStateToProps "傳"到props,你就可以拿來顯示啦;你修改store的操作,也通過mapDispatchToProps "傳" 到props,你就可以修改數(shù)據(jù)啦

糖豆豆 回答
Vue.use(Router)
const router=new Router({
  mode: 'history',
  //base: process.env.BASE_URL,
  routes: [
    ...
  ]
})
new Vue({
  router,
  el: '#app',
  data: {
    message: 'Hello Vue.js!',
    isLogin:false
  },
  methods:{
      move(){
          console.log('ddd')
      }
  }
})

還有就是vue的腳手架是vue的精華,建議使用@vue/cli來創(chuàng)建項目